Clarksville, Ark. - The Centenary women's basketball team will face the University of the Ozarks Eagles in a non-conference contest set for 1 p.m. on Saturday inside Mabee Gymnasium.

The Ladies (1-4) return to regular-season play after a pair of road exhibition contests earlier this week. Centenary fell at ULM in Monroe 70-36 on Monday and 91-53 to McNeese on Wednesday in Lake Charles.

The Eagles (3-2) lost an exhibition on Tuesday at Arkansas State, 95-49, and will be playing their first home game of the season on Saturday. The Eagles and Ladies will meet for he first time since the 2016-17 season with Ozarks having won five of the previous six meetings.

The Ladies were led in scoring on Wednesday at McNeese by junior F Jazzmyn Jones (Normangee, Texas) with 12 points in 34 minutes. She shot 5-17 overall from the floor, 2-4 from the free throw line, grabbed four rebounds, and had three steals with a pair of assists and one blocked shot.

Centenary shot 29.7 % overall, went 3-11 from beyond the arc, and was 12-23 from the free throw line. The Ladies turned the ball over 18 times while the Cowgirls gave it up 19 times.

Sophomore guard Addy Tremie (Sulphur, La.) scored nine points for the second-straight game as she went 3-8 from three-point range and had one rebound and one steal in 37 minutes of action. Freshman G Alana Jones (Shreveport) also scored nine in 30 minutes. She was 3-8 overall, 3-4 from the free throw line, and had a team-high nine rebounds. She also recorded three steals and had one blocked shot. Her nine points and nine rebounds are season bests for the rookie.

Freshman G Mary Leday (Opelousas, La.) had nine points of her own in 24 minutes, shooting 3-11 from the floor and 3-4 from the free throw line. She had six rebounds with an assist. Junior Destini Powell (Minden, La.) played 20 minutes and scored three points, had three assists, and grabbed two rebounds. Senior G Jennae Mayberry (Clovis, Calif.) scored six in 25 minutes and had two steals with an assist and a rebound.

Freshman G Dymon Drumgo (Alexandria, La.) scored two points in 12 minutes off the bench with a pair of rebounds. Junior F Amelia Bagwell (West Monroe, La.) played eight minutes and finished with one point and two rebounds. Freshman F Katelyn Simon (Lafayette, La.) scored two points with two rebounds and one assists in six minutes. Centenary finished with nine assists, nine steals, and a pair of blocked shots.

Jones leads the team in scoring, averaging 12.8 PPG and is third in rebounding at 4.6 per game. She is also leading the team in shooting percentage at 51.1 % overall from the floor. Tremie is second at 12.4 PPG and averages 5.0 rebounds per game, second on the team. Mayberry is the leading rebounder, averaging 6.5/game and averages 3.8 PPG. Leday averages 6.6 PPG and Powell is averaging 6.2.

Centenary currently ranks second in the Southern Collegiate Athletic Conference in both scoring defense (61.0 PPG) and field goal percentage defense (.336). The Ladies are also fourth in three-point FG % defense (.234) and rank fourth in steals with 51 (10.2/game).

Jones ranks fifth in the SCAC in FG % and is sixth in scoring while Tremie is eight in scoring. Mayberry is tied for 16th in rebounding and Tremie ranks 18th. Leday is 11th in assists and she and Jones are tied for third in the conference in steals. Bagwell is tied for 14th in free throw % at .714 and Alana Jones and Tremie are tied for 12th in steals. Tremie and Powell are currently seventh and 13th respectively in three-point FG % and sixth and 11th in three-point field goals made.

Jazzmyn Jones is also 14th in both blocked shots and offensive rebounds while Powell is ninth in defensive rebounds and Mayberry and Tremie are 11th and 15th in the category. Tremie is second in minutes played, averaging 36.4/game.

The Maroon and White have held four of their five opponents under 65 points, as only Louisiana Christian University has topped 70, in a 71-56 at the Gold Dome on Nov. 12.

The Ladies complete their weekend on Sunday with another non-conference game at Hendrix College in Conway, Ark. at 1 p.m.
